The 5th Meeting of the Committee on Social Communication and Media Sciences of the Polish Academy of Sciences: A Position Statement on Public Media

On 4 July 2024, the 5th meeting of the Committee on Social Communication and Media Sciences of the Polish Academy of Sciences was held online under the chairmanship of Prof. Iwona Hofman. During the proceedings, the Chair presented information concerning the planned amendment to the Act on the Polish Academy of Sciences and the principles governing the operation and evaluation of scientific committees, emphasizing the importance of an active and substantive presence of the academic community in decision-making processes related to science and state public policies.

The central and most prominent point of the meeting was a debate on the reform of public media in Poland. At the request of the team led by Prof. Stanisław Jędrzejewski, the Committee unanimously adopted a position statement on the proposed legislative changes, prepared in response to ministerial consultations on the new media law and the implementation of the European Media Freedom Act. The discussion emphasized the need to guarantee genuine editorial independence, stable and transparent funding of public media, and the protection of pluralism and the public interest in the context of profound regulatory changes.

In concluding the meeting, Prof. Iwona Hofman highlighted the role of the Committee as an expert forum that not only monitors legislative processes but also actively co-shapes public debate on the media system and social communication. The meeting confirmed the Committee’s readiness to continue speaking out on issues crucial to media democracy, including the reform of public media and forthcoming changes in copyright law and regulations governing the media market.
